What Are Your Fees for Services?

What payment structures does a lawyer typically use for their services? Personal injury lawyers commonly use a contingency fee structure, meaning they only receive payment if the client wins the case. This type of agreement can relieve monetary stress for clients facing medical costs or reduced earnings. Generally, the attorney will collect an agreed-upon percentage of the settlement or court award, which typically falls between 25% and 40%.

Some lawyers may also offer flat fees or hourly rates, although these approaches are not as frequently used in personal injury cases. It is crucial for clients to understand the fee structure before agreeing to any terms. Furthermore, clients ought to ask about any additional expenses that may emerge throughout the legal proceedings, including court filing fees or expert witness costs. Grasping these financial considerations is critical to making well-informed choices when retaining a car accident attorney.

How Should I Get Ready for Our First Consultation?

In preparation for the initial appointment, individuals should compile relevant documents including accident reports, medical records, and insurance information. In addition, compiling a list of pertinent questions and case information will facilitate a thorough and meaningful dialogue.
